Introduction

The Strategic Entrepreneurship Journal, published by WILEY, is a premier platform dedicated to advancing the field of entrepreneurial strategy, aiming to publish high-quality research that unravels the complexities of entrepreneurship within business contexts. With its ISSN 1932-4391 and E-ISSN 1932-443X, this journal has established itself as a leading resource, earning Q1 rankings in 2023 across key categories including Business and International Management, Economics and Econometrics, and Strategy and Management. As a testament to its academic rigor and influence, the journal ranks in the top percentile of Scopus metrics, positioned at the 94th percentile in Economics and Econometrics and 90th percentile in Business and Management fields. Focusing on topics that bridge strategic theory and practical entrepreneurship, the journal aims not just to publish findings, but to foster discussions that drive innovation and growth across industries. Researchers, scholars, and professionals seeking to deepen their understanding and application of strategic entrepreneurship will find an invaluable resource in each issue, contributing to both academic advancement and practical application in today’s dynamic business landscape.

ENTREPRENEURSHIP AND REGIONAL DEVELOPMENT

Catalyzing Regional Prosperity through Research
Publisher: ROUTLEDGE JOURNALS, TAYLOR & FRANCIS LTDISSN: 0898-5626Frequency: 10 issues/year

Entrepreneurship and Regional Development is a prestigious academic journal published by Routledge Journals, Taylor & Francis Ltd, with a significant influence in the fields of business and international management, development, and economics. Established in 1989, this journal has dedicated itself to advancing knowledge and scholarship by exploring the intricate relationships between entrepreneurship and regional development dynamics. With its commendable Q1 status across multiple categories in 2023 and a strong ranking in Scopus, it positions itself among the elite in its domain, making it a vital resource for researchers, professionals, and students alike. Although it is not an Open Access journal, its robust subscription base ensures widespread accessibility to cutting-edge research. The journal aims to highlight innovative empirical research and theoretical advancements, contributing to the understanding of how entrepreneurship fuels economic growth and regional sustainability. As such, Entrepreneurship and Regional Development plays a crucial role in shaping policy and practice across academic, governmental, and community environments.
